Output ec427ec5c31f2cdf95a16a91c7f4ce928bb7caa00e5137ad94e079e042d18d63:0

value
19308520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 048da6d2c703c6973f34ab874be27c971e19463d OP_EQUAL
address
3276KSWAFELLAVQdMSHHPATaRZynLezuyc
transaction
ec427ec5c31f2cdf95a16a91c7f4ce928bb7caa00e5137ad94e079e042d18d63
spent
true